Some ideas are by frequency and strength of association so closely combined that they cannot be separated; if one exists, the other exists along with it in spite of whatever effort we make to disjoin them.” (Analysis of the Human Mind, 2nd ed., vol. i, p. 93)

That is the relationship for me between ful mudammas and classical Egyptian music. During my undergraduate years as a student of architecture, I was introduced to both of them. All-nighters were quite common; in fact they were expected of us as we were given deadlines that gave us no other choice but to stay up all night, time and again.

Um Kalthoum and Abdel Halim Hafiz made the long nights bearable and lively. The role of ful mudammas came later, during the early morning hours. We would drive to Old Jeddah for the Fajr prayer, then right after, it was ful time. The traditional restaurants where it was served were simple and unpretentious. The ful would be cooking all night in a copper pot and is timed to be ready by Fajr time, perfectly synchronized with our all-nighters. It is served with tamees, a traditional bread baked in a tandoori oven. The ful is topped with blended tomatoes, ground cumin, salt and ground black pepper.

A breakfast of ful mudammas, tamees and tea with milk, provided us with a boost of energy that made it possible for us to go to classes in the morning and concentrate.

In many parts of the Middle East, ful mudammas is a must for breaking the fast in Ramadan. By late afternoon, long lines form at ful joints. Ful is also great for suhoor (the pre-dawn meal during Ramadan). The song we chose for the video is by Sayyed Makkawi who was well-known for his role as the Missaharati (announcer of the pre-dawn meal). He composed music for Um Kalthoum and was also a great singer.

Both ful mudammas and classical Egyptian music are addictive. Both slow, both to be savoured. For some, inseparable, an association that can be lifelong.

Ingredients:

(Tbsp is a tablespoon; tsp is a teaspoon)
(1 cup = 237 mL = 2.4 dl; 1 Tbsp = 15 mL; 1 tsp = 5 mL); all are level measurements

 

Ful Mudammas:

  • 1 lb (450 g) Small dry fava beans
  • 6 cups (1.5 litres) Water – For soaking
  • 2 (275 g) Medium tomatoes (chopped)
  • 1 (130 g) Medium onion (chopped)
  • ¼ cup (80 g) Cilantro (chopped) – UK: coriander
  • 4 Large garlic cloves (minced)
  • 2 tsp (10 mL) Salt – To taste
  • ¼ tsp (1.25 mL) Ground black pepper
  • 1 tsp (5 mL) Xawaash – Somali spice mix
  • 6 cups (1.5 litres) Water – For cooking
  • 2 Lemon slices
  • 1 Large garlic clove

Tomato Blend:

  • 2 (275 g) Medium tomatoes (blended)
  • ¼ tsp (1.25 mL) Xawaash
  • ⅛ tsp Ground black pepper (Pinch)
  • ¼ tsp (1.25 mL) Salt – To taste
  • 1 tsp (5 mL) Olive oil

Chili Oil:

  • ½ cup (118 mL) Olive oil
  • 2 Jalapeno peppers (chopped)

Directions:

Dry fava beans


 

Dry fava beans


 

Steps for preparing ful mudammas

  1. Wash the beans and boil for 10 minutes.
  2. Turn off the heat then cover and let the beans soak for one hour.
  3. After one hour elapsed, drain the water and wash the beans. Put the beans in a 5 litre clean pot. Add all the other ingredients except for the one garlic.
  4. Cover and cook on medium heat for one hour. Stir after every 15 minutes.
  5. Mash the beans using a laddle, or a wooden spoon.
  6. Add the garlic and cook for another 10 minutes.

    Thanks so much for this recipe. I notice that you did not remove the outer skin of the beans. I keep reading from Western websites that you need to do this, however, I recently met people from Morocco, Palestine, and Israel who all said they did not ever remove the skin. Taking their advice, I just cooked some semi-mature beans (from my garden – they were part fresh and part dry) and they definitely have a rather tough skin that is unpleasant to eat. Are Westerners just sensitive to this or does it depend on the type of fava bean?

    • A&L
      May 8, 2014 | 11:12 pm

      Yes, it depends on the type of fava beans. Small fava beans do not need to be peeled. However, the large, broad beans have to be peeled. Even in the middle east, the large ones are always peeled.

      • Renee Perry
        May 30, 2014 | 10:17 am

        Thank you for that information. Do you ever use the large ones? Are they worth the effort? Is there an easy way to peel them?

        • A&L
          June 2, 2014 | 1:53 am

          We find the smaller ones a lot more convenient. For the broad beans, the less dry they are the easier it is to peel. Fresh ones are usually blanched, then peeled one by one. For dry beans, we suggest soaking them over night, boiling in fresh water for half an hour, then Peeling individually.
